Understanding the Ford Fiesta's Transmission Landscape
Over its long production run, the Ford Fiesta has been offered with a variety of gearbox options, catering to different driving preferences and market demands. Traditionally, manual transmissions have been the backbone of the Fiesta's drivetrain, known for their robustness and direct engagement. However, as automatic transmissions gained popularity for their convenience, Ford introduced several automatic options into the Fiesta line-up.
The critical distinction lies between the conventional torque-converter automatics (found in older models or specific markets) and the dual-clutch automatic transmission, specifically the DPS6, often marketed as 'PowerShift'. This latter type is where the majority of issues have stemmed from, leading to a stark contrast in perceived reliability between manual and automatic Fiesta models from certain years. It's vital for owners and potential buyers to understand which type of transmission their vehicle possesses or is likely to have, as this directly correlates with the likelihood of encountering problems.
The Infamous PowerShift (DPS6) Automatic Transmission
The Ford PowerShift dual-clutch automatic transmission (DPS6) was introduced in Ford Fiesta models from approximately 2011 through to 2016/2017, primarily paired with the 1.0-litre EcoBoost and 1.6-litre petrol engines. On paper, it was designed to offer the fuel efficiency of a manual gearbox with the convenience of an automatic, using two dry clutches to pre-select the next gear, theoretically leading to seamless and rapid shifts.
However, in practice, this transmission became the Achilles' heel for many Fiesta owners. Unlike traditional wet-clutch dual-clutch systems that use fluid to cool and lubricate the clutches, the DPS6 utilised a dry-clutch design. This design, combined with software calibration issues and the inherent limitations of dry clutches in stop-start urban driving, led to premature wear and a host of operational problems. The constant engagement and disengagement of the clutches in low-speed traffic caused excessive heat build-up and accelerated wear, resulting in the notorious juddering and hesitation that plagued thousands of owners.
Ford faced numerous class-action lawsuits, particularly in the US, regarding the widespread failures of this transmission, eventually extending warranties and offering various fixes. Despite these efforts, the reputation of the PowerShift Fiesta models was significantly tarnished, making them a cautionary tale for those seeking a trouble-free automatic driving experience.
Common Symptoms of PowerShift Transmission Failure
Identifying a failing PowerShift transmission often involves experiencing a range of distinct and frustrating symptoms. These issues tend to worsen over time if left unaddressed:
- Juddering or Shuddering: This is perhaps the most common symptom. The vehicle will shake or vibrate noticeably, especially during acceleration from a standstill or at low speeds (e.g., in traffic). It feels as if the clutch is slipping or grabbing inconsistently.
- Hesitation and Delayed Engagement: When accelerating, particularly from a stop or after slowing down, there might be a noticeable delay before the transmission engages a gear. This can be disconcerting and potentially dangerous in traffic.
- Harsh or Erratic Shifting: Gear changes can feel abrupt, jerky, or even violent, rather than smooth. The transmission might also 'hunt' for gears, shifting up and down unnecessarily.
- Grinding or Whirring Noises: Unusual mechanical noises coming from the transmission area, especially during gear changes or when the vehicle is in motion, can indicate internal wear.
- Loss of Power: In some severe cases, the transmission might fail to transmit power efficiently to the wheels, leading to a significant reduction in acceleration or even complete loss of drive.
- Check Engine Light or Transmission Warning Light: While not always specific to the transmission, these warning lights on the dashboard can illuminate when the Transmission Control Module (TCM) detects a fault.
- Intermittent Problems: The issues might not be constant, appearing more frequently when the car is warm, in heavy traffic, or after prolonged driving.
These symptoms not only compromise the driving experience but can also raise safety concerns, particularly the hesitation and loss of power.
Root Causes and Technical Explanations
The fundamental problems with the Ford PowerShift DPS6 transmission boil down to a combination of design flaws and component weaknesses:
- Dry Clutch Design: As mentioned, the dry clutches are not designed to handle the constant slipping and heat generation associated with stop-and-go driving. Unlike wet clutches, they lack a fluid-cooling mechanism, leading to rapid wear of the clutch plates.
- Transmission Control Module (TCM) Failure: The TCM is the computer that controls the transmission's operations. Many PowerShift units suffered from faulty TCMs, which could lead to incorrect shifting patterns, sensor malfunctions, and even complete transmission failure. These electronic failures often compounded the mechanical issues.
- Input Shaft Seal Leaks: Although less common than clutch or TCM issues, some units experienced leaks from the input shaft seals. While not directly causing the juddering, these leaks could contaminate the dry clutches with fluid, leading to slipping and accelerated wear.
- Software Calibration: Early versions of the PowerShift software were poorly calibrated for the dry clutch design, exacerbating the juddering and hesitation. While Ford issued numerous software updates, they often provided only temporary relief or did not fully resolve the underlying mechanical issues.
The Costly Reality of Repairs
Repairing a failing PowerShift transmission can be an expensive undertaking. The most common repairs involve:
- Clutch Pack Replacement: This is a frequent necessity due to premature wear. The cost can be significant, often ranging from hundreds to over a thousand pounds, depending on the garage and parts used.
- TCM Replacement: Replacing the Transmission Control Module is also a common repair, and due to the complexity of the part and programming, it can be similarly costly.
- Full Transmission Replacement/Rebuild: In severe cases, or after multiple failed repairs, a complete transmission replacement or a full rebuild may be the only viable option, which can run into several thousands of pounds, often exceeding the value of older Fiesta models.
It's important to note that even after repairs, some owners report that the issues can resurface, leading to a cycle of frustration and repeated trips to the garage. This lack of long-term reliability has been a major point of contention for affected owners.
Manual Transmissions: A Reliable Alternative
In stark contrast to the PowerShift automatic, the manual transmissions offered in the Ford Fiesta are generally considered very robust and reliable. Ford's manual gearboxes, typically 5-speed or 6-speed units, are known for their light, precise shifts and longevity. If you are considering a used Ford Fiesta and reliability is a top priority, opting for a model with a manual gearbox significantly reduces the risk of encountering costly transmission problems. These units are far less prone to the widespread issues seen with their automatic counterparts, making them the preferred choice for many.
Buying a Used Ford Fiesta: What to Look For
If you're in the market for a used Ford Fiesta, especially one from the 2011-2017 era, careful inspection and a thorough test drive are paramount. Here's what to look out for:
- Check the Transmission Type: Confirm whether it's a manual or an automatic. If it's an automatic, proceed with extreme caution.
- Service History: A comprehensive service history is crucial. Look for any records of transmission-related work, recalls, or software updates.
- Test Drive Thoroughly (Automatic): If it's an automatic, pay close attention during the test drive.
- Start from a standstill on a slight incline. Does it judder or hesitate?
- Drive in stop-start traffic conditions if possible. Observe how it behaves at low speeds.
- Accelerate moderately and then firmly. Are shifts smooth or harsh?
- Listen for any grinding, whirring, or clunking noises.
- Check for Warning Lights: Ensure no check engine or transmission warning lights are illuminated on the dashboard.
- Professional Inspection: Consider having a pre-purchase inspection performed by an independent mechanic who is familiar with Ford vehicles, especially the PowerShift transmission. They can often identify subtle signs of wear or impending failure.
Preventative Measures and Maintenance Tips
For owners of a Ford Fiesta with a PowerShift transmission, preventative maintenance can be challenging due to the inherent design flaws. However, keeping up with general vehicle maintenance can help prolong the life of components:
- Regular Servicing: Adhere to Ford's recommended service schedule. While the DPS6 is considered a 'sealed for life' unit by Ford, some independent specialists recommend fluid changes, though this is debated and typically won't prevent the core clutch/TCM issues.
- Gentle Driving: Minimise aggressive acceleration and braking, especially in stop-and-go traffic, to reduce stress on the dry clutches.
- Monitor Symptoms: Be vigilant for any of the symptoms mentioned above. Early detection can sometimes lead to less costly repairs, though often the issue is already significant by the time symptoms appear.
For manual Fiesta owners, regular clutch fluid checks (if applicable) and general gearbox oil changes as per manufacturer recommendations will help ensure longevity.

Frequently Asked Questions About Ford Fiesta Transmissions
Q: Are all Ford Fiesta automatic transmissions problematic?
A: No, the vast majority of documented issues relate specifically to the PowerShift (DPS6) dual-clutch automatic transmission found in models from roughly 2011 to 2017, particularly with the 1.0 EcoBoost and 1.6 petrol engines. Older conventional automatics and manual transmissions are generally reliable.
Q: How can I tell if a Ford Fiesta has the problematic PowerShift transmission?
A: Check the model year (2011-2017 are most suspect) and the engine type (1.0 EcoBoost or 1.6 petrol). If it's an automatic from these years with these engines, it's highly likely to have the PowerShift. A test drive will quickly reveal symptoms like juddering or hesitation.
Q: Is there a recall for the Ford Fiesta PowerShift transmission?
A: While there wasn't a universal safety recall in the UK for the PowerShift transmission, Ford did issue numerous technical service bulletins (TSBs), software updates, and extended warranties in various regions (including the US) to address the problems. It's advisable to check with a Ford dealership about any applicable service actions for a specific VIN.
Q: What is the average lifespan of a PowerShift transmission?
A: Unfortunately, the lifespan can be unpredictable. Many started exhibiting significant problems well before 100,000 miles, with some failing much earlier. It heavily depends on driving conditions and how well the specific unit was manufactured and calibrated.
Q: Can I get my PowerShift transmission repaired, or do I need a full replacement?
A: Repairs often involve replacing the clutch pack or the Transmission Control Module (TCM). While these can temporarily resolve the issues, some owners report recurring problems. A full replacement or rebuild is an option for severe cases, but it's typically very costly.
Q: Are manual Ford Fiestas reliable?
A: Yes, generally very much so. Ford's manual transmissions in the Fiesta are known for their durability and lack the widespread issues associated with the PowerShift automatic. They are often the recommended choice for reliability.
Q: Should I avoid buying a Ford Fiesta with a PowerShift automatic?
A: It's highly recommended to approach such models with extreme caution. If you must have an automatic Fiesta, consider models outside the 2011-2017 range, or be prepared for potential, costly transmission issues. A manual Fiesta remains the safest bet for long-term reliability.
